Publisher's Synopsis

Once regarded as fashionable, smoking is now considered dangerous and anti-social. This book is designed for all those who want to give up smoking but don't know quite how to do it. Methods of stopping and the withdrawal symptoms to expect are outlined, and possible help and alternatives are discussed, such as dummy cigarettes, nicotine chewing gum and acupuncture. Changing daily routines, exercise and removing temptations are also covered.
